Transaction 3889576e36028ca5c270c3f27efee14ae0d24a0096dcb9186bb8276d534dc155
1 Input
1 Output
-
3889576e36028ca5c270c3f27efee14ae0d24a0096dcb9186bb8276d534dc155:0
- value
- 389882
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ab867b5c933130c4554883b2198b7b362fb1992a OP_EQUAL
- address
- 3HKxaK2kQMdCQaRCHo99o9f42ijQhedMqG